Health Study Guide 9 & 10 questions
already passed
true or false? one alcoholic drink equals 10 ounces of beer, malt liquor, wine, or distilled spirits.

✔✔false, there is only .6 once in one drink




alcohol is a _______, or a type of drug that slows down the central nervous system.

✔✔depressant




alcohol can negatively impact the cerebal _______, which controls thought processing and

consciousness. ✔✔cortex




once alcohol is consumed, it stays in the body until the liver can break down, or _______ the

alcohol. ✔✔metabolize




how can alcohol, a liquid, dehydrate the body? ✔✔when vasopressin is no longer produced,

liquids go straight to the bladder and are expelled through the urinary tract. drinking alcohol

leads the body to expel about four times as much liquid as was consumed, causes dehydration.

, true or false? there is a relationship between alcohol use and the number of accidents and

violence incidents in the US ✔✔true




______ is a medical emergency caused when a high blood concentration suppresses the central

nervous system and can result in a loss of consciousness, low blood pressure, low body

temperature, and difficulty breathing ✔✔alcohol poisoning




the buildup of scar tissue in the lives is called _______. ✔✔cirrhosis




which of the following describes a possible symptom of fetal alcohol syndrome?




a. decreased muscle tone and poor coordination

b. delayed development and problems with thinking, speech, movement, and social skills

c. heart defects


d. all of the above ✔✔d. all of the above




why is alcohol especially dangerous for adolescents ✔✔they are at a greater risk experiencing

health problems. these problems can affect teens quality of life and athletic performance. these

problems are physical, school, family, social, and legal problems.
